Tommy uk: I e-mailed Mike Griffith a few weeks back asking when the next applications would be accepted. This is what he said:

Dear Edward,

The Next Stage 2 for NetJets is too early for you. It will be during October and
selecting cadets for Spring 2009. Within the next month or so, we will post an
application closing deate for the October Stage 2. The application will then be
removed from our website on thnat closing date.

We are abandoning the rolling application that we used this year, in favour of
shorter application periods designed to fill specific vacancies. The vacant course
dates will be announced each time the application is re-opened. You will need to
keep an eye on our website for announcements and check the dates to know when to
apply. The course that would most likely suit you would be October 2009 and I
estimate that we will need to recruit for that course around May 2009.

Mike

We regret that we have been advised by NetJets Europe (NJE) that the current market instability, and in particular the uncertain impact it is having on all airlines, means that NJE believe it would be imprudent to go ahead with the cadet selection programme scheduled to begin next week. Consequently, NJE have requested OAA to cancel the selection arrangements.

NJE have stressed that their plans for continued growth remain in place, but the company nevertheless considers it sensible to limit short term recruitment commitments pending the restoration of market stability. Thus, whilst NetJets remains firmly committed to the successful ab-initio cadet programme entered into with Oxford Aviation Academy (OAA) in 2006, it has taken the decision to temporarily suspend new cadet selection and therefore not to run the Stage 2 selection process planned for next week.
